Planning a Safe Google Chrome download on a New PC
A new PC is a clean table with a few factory tools already sitting on it. Planning a safe Google Chrome download means deciding who owns the table, who may sit there, and whether anyone should sign into a personal account on day one. Write those decisions on paper if the household argues. Software will not settle an argument about mailboxes.
Own the machine before you change it
If the PC belongs to a school or an employer, the plan is a conversation, not an installer. Many images already include a browser and a policy that blocks unknown setup files. That block is not an insult. It is a contract. Use this unofficial desk on a machine you are allowed to configure. If you are allowed, continue. If you are not, stop and keep the issued tools.
Make room and name the folders
Before you download Chrome for Windows, open the downloads folder and see whether last season leftover files are still there. Delete only what you can name. Leave disk space for the program, the profile, and a month of cache. A drive that is already warning you will make any install feel like a failure. The failure would be the full disk, not the browser.
Decide sign-in later
A Google Chrome download does not require an account. On a new PC that will be shared, that fact is a gift. Plan to launch locally, set a homepage, and create named profiles. Sign-in can wait until a person is using a machine they alone carry. Tabs that follow you are useful on a personal laptop and risky on a living-room tower. Planning is the act of saying that sentence out loud before the window opens.

How a Google Chrome download Differs on Phones
A phone does not want a setup executable. It wants a store record. That is the entire difference, and households still blur it because the product name is the same. A Google Chrome download on iOS is the App Store listing. On Android it is the Play Store listing. There is no honest shortcut that replaces those records with a file you move by cable. People who offer that shortcut are not continuing this guide. They are leaving it.
On a phone you already use, you may find a copy of the browser waiting. Updating it through the store is still a download in the ordinary sense. You are refreshing the same product, not installing a cousin. Check the store account. A forgotten account is a more common blocker than a missing package. Recover the account, then let the store finish. Do not hunt for an APK because a banner told you the store was slow.
Permissions on a phone feel more intimate than permissions on a tower. A camera, a location ping, and a notification badge all sit closer to daily life. Grant what a map or a video call needs in the moment. Refuse the rest for a week. You can change a permission later. You cannot easily untangle a week of notifications you never wanted. This is educational advice, not a scare. Phones are loud when we let them be loud.
If you also need a desktop window, treat that as a second errand. Install the phone copy, then sit at the PC and download Chrome for Windows from the same desk. The two installs do not complete each other. They only meet if you later sign into both. Many people never should. A student laptop and a personal phone can remain strangers and still both run Google Chrome well.

After You Finish the Google Chrome Setup
The hour after setup is when households either settle or clutter. Open the window. Look at the empty tab. Resist the urge to install every companion you remember from an older machine. Open one site you already trust: a school portal, a newspaper you pay for, a bill pay page. Confirm the network path is ordinary. Then stop for tea. That pause is part of the setup even if no wizard mentions it.
Name the rooms
Create profiles with human names, not with colors. A room called School and a room called Bills will still make sense in winter. A room called Pink will not. Keep a guest room if cousins visit. Do not store a tax login in the guest room. If the PC is yours alone, one room may be enough. Extra rooms are a tool, not a score.
Set a homepage and a bookmark cabinet
A homepage is a porch. Choose one. Bookmarks are the cabinet. Make a few folders and put only the sites you will still need next month. Use the reading list for articles you intend to finish tonight. Mixing the two is how people lose both. Google Chrome will keep whatever you file. It will not file for you.
Meet the permission prompts
Camera, microphone, and notifications will ask. Answer one host at a time. A video call can have the camera. A shopping site does not need a doorbell in the kitchen. You can reopen the lock icon later and change your mind. The first week is for learning that the lock icon exists.
If the first evening feels heavy, open the built-in task manager and see which tab is spending memory. Close that tab. If the machine is still unhappy, close other programs that start with Windows. After you finish the Google Chrome setup, the browser is one weight in the bag. It is rarely the only weight. People who skip this look often blame the new window for an old pile of startup tools.
Long-Term Habits That Keep Google Chrome Reliable
Reliability a year later is a set of manners, not a hidden switch. Update through the product, not through a drawer of old setup files. Return to this desk when you image a second PC or replace a phone, not every Tuesday. The about screen inside the browser will tell you the build. This unofficial site will tell you which doors are still the four official channels.
Review extensions the way you review house guests. If you cannot remember why a guest has a key, take the key back. Prefer few add-ons from publishers you can name. A coupon extra that arrived during a late purchase is a common source of a noisy toolbar. Removing it is a habit, not an admission of failure. Everyone who uses the web collects a guest they later walk to the door.
Review saved passwords on shared machines. If a child can open a parent mailbox, the mailbox was stored in the wrong room. Move it. Turn off save prompts on the living-room profile. Keep them on a personal handset if you want that convenience. A Google Chrome download does not decide this for you. The household does, and the household should revisit the decision after holidays when visitors have used the tower.
